Basketball Africa League 2nd Round to take place in Rwanda
Jerry Muhamudu

The second round of the Basketball Africa league will take place in Rwanda starting from 17th to 22nd December at Kigali Arena complex.
Eight teams will contest for the title, and will be divided into two pools of four teams each. Each team will take on their three opponents in a round-robin format.
Eventually, the top two teams from each group will advance to the semi-finals, where the teams that finish in the first three places will qualify for the Basketball Africa League regular season in March 2020.
Teams in Group H include: Patriots /Rwanda, City Oilers /Uganda, Ferroviario de Maputo /Mozambique, GNBC /Madagascar, Kenya Ports Authority /Kenya and UNZA Pacers /Zambia
Those on Wild Card are: JKT /Tanzania and Cobra /South Sudan.
